O‘TKIR TONZILLITNI DAVOLASHDA BOLALARDA INGALASYON BAKTERIOFAG TERAPIYASINI IMMUN TIZIMGA TA'SIRI

Mavzuning dolzarbligi. Bolalarda o‘tkir tonzillitni (O‘T) o‘z vaqtida tashxislash va davolash ambulator-poliklinik yordamining dolzarb yo‘nalishlaridan biri bo‘lib qolmoqda. Shu bilan birga, keyingi yillarda bakteriofaglar yordamida davolash usullarini joriy etish pediatriyada dolzarb tendentsiyaga aylandi. Tadqiqot maqsadi. O‘T bilan og'rigan bolalarning mahalliy immun tizimiga ingalyatsion bakteriofag terapiyasining (IBT) ta'sirini tahlil qilish. Tadqiqot materiallari va uslullari. Tadqiqot boshqariladigan randomizatsion usul yordamida o‘tkazildi. O‘T bilan og'rigan 4 yoshdan 15 yoshgacha bo‘lgan jami 212 nafar bola va 110 nafar amalda sog'lom bolalar (nazorat guruhi) tekshirildi. Birinchi guruhga standart umumiy davolanishni olgan O‘T bilan og'rigan 107 bemor bolalar kiritildi. Ikkinchi guruh 105 boladan iborat bo‘lib, ular standart davolanishga qo‘shimcha ravishda IBT olgan. Immunologik tadqiqotlar sIgA va TNF-a ni aniqlashni o‘z ichiga oladi. IBT pyobacteriophag-PLC (RF) yordamida amalga oshirildi. Natijalar. O‘T bilan og'rigan bolalarda kasallikning birinchi kunida sIgA darajasining pasayishi kuzatildi (kichik bolalarda - 40,9% gacha, o‘smirlarda - 41,9% gacha). Ikkala yosh guruhida davolanishning oltinchi kunida sIgA ning IBT bilan olgan bemorlarda - 96,9% gacha, IBT olmagan bemorlarga - 80,7% gacha o‘sishi qayd etildi. Xuddi shunday o‘zgarishlar TNF-a darajasini o‘rganishda ham kuzatildi. Kasallikning o‘tkir bosqichida yuqori bo‘lgan TNF-a darajasi davolanish davrida asta-sekin kamaydi. IBT olgan bolalarda davolanishning uchinchi kunida TNF-a boshlang'ich darajadan o‘rtacha 11,0% gacha, davolashning oltinchi kunida esa 17% gacha kamaydi. Xulosa. O‘tkir tonzillit bilan kassallangan bolalarni kompleks davolashda ingalatsion bakteriofag terapiyasidan foydalanish mahalliy immunitet ko‘rsatkichlarining 16,3% ga yaxshilanishi fonida, kasallikning klinik belgilarini 1,39 baravar ijobiy tamonga siljishga yordam berdi (p≤0,05).
